AICAR (5-Aminoimidazole-4-carboxamide ribonucleotide), also known as acadesine, is a naturally occurring intermediate in the purine biosynthesis pathway and a well-established activator of AMP-activated protein kinase (AMPK). As an AMPK agonist, AICAR mimics the cellular effects of low energy status, triggering downstream signalling cascades that regulate glucose uptake, fatty acid oxidation, mitochondrial biogenesis, and cellular metabolism.
In preclinical research, AICAR has been extensively investigated for its potential applications in metabolic disorders, including type 2 diabetes and obesity, where AMPK activation plays a central role in restoring insulin sensitivity and improving lipid profiles. Studies have also explored its relevance in cardiovascular research, where it has demonstrated cardioprotective properties, and in skeletal muscle physiology, where it has been shown to enhance oxidative capacity and endurance-like adaptations in animal models.
Additional research areas include its anti-inflammatory properties, potential neuroprotective effects, and involvement in cancer cell metabolism, where AMPK modulation may influence tumour cell energy homeostasis.
